What is Private Psychiatry?
Private psychiatry involves the provision of mental health services outside the National Health Service (NHS). These services are used by psychiatrists who can detect and treat a variety of mental health conditions. Patients frequently look for private psychiatric care when they desire access to prompt services, choose an alternative treatment choice to the NHS, or desire a more customized method to their mental health concerns.
Why Choose a Private Psychiatrist?
While the NHS offers necessary mental health services, there are a number of reasons people might pick to seek private care:

Shorter Waiting Times: Accessing a psychiatrist through the NHS can involve prolonged waiting times. Private services normally offer quicker appointments, which can be crucial for those in need of instant assistance.

Personalized Care: Private psychiatrists frequently have more time to spend with each client, enabling a tailored treatment plan that lines up with the client's particular requirements.

Wider Options for Treatment: In a private setting, patients may have access to numerous treatment methods that might not be offered through the NHS, consisting of complementary therapies.

Privacy and Comfort: Many individuals prefer the discretion and personal privacy related to private care, which can also create a more comfortable treatment environment.

Knowledge and Specialization: Patients can select experts based on their particular conditions or preferences, which is particularly advantageous in complicated cases.

Selecting a private psychiatrist can appear overwhelming, however breaking down the decision-making procedure can make it more manageable. Here are actions to think about when picking the right psychiatrist near me private:

Assess Your Needs: Before beginning your search, determine what you need help with. This could be specific mental health issues, favored treatment styles, or logistical factors to consider like location and cost.

Research Qualifications and Specializations: Ensure that the psychiatrist is signed up with the General Medical Council (GMC) and has training in psychiatry. It can be useful to find somebody who focuses on your area of issue, whether it's stress and anxiety, anxiety, or PTSD.

Check Reviews and Recommendations: Look for evaluations online or request for suggestions from trusted sources. Firsthand accounts can provide important insights into the psychiatrist's technique and efficiency.

Consider Logistics: Location, availability, and costs are important factors. Examine how to find a private psychiatrist uk these logistical factors to consider fit into your life and budget plan.

Arrange Initial Consultations: Meeting potential psychiatrists supplies a firsthand feel for their design. Utilize this opportunity to discuss your history and see if you feel comfy with their approach.

Q1: Is private psychiatry private practice expensive?A1: The cost of
private psychiatry can vary substantially depending upon the psychiatrist's experience and specialization. Initial assessments may vary from ₤ 150 to ₤ 400, while continuous sessions could be around ₤ 100 to ₤ 250 per session. Q2: Can I see a private psychiatrist without a referral?A2: Yes

, patients can self-refer to a private psychiatrist private practice. Unlike NHS services, private care does not require a referral from a general professional. Q3: Does private psychiatric care provide faster access to medication?A3: Yes, private psychiatrists can
assess your requirements rapidly and prescribe medication at your very first appointment if considered essential. Q4: Will my private treatment be confidential?A4: Yes, private settings usually prioritize patient privacy. Nevertheless, it's important to talk about any concerns
upfront with your psychiatrist. Q5: Can I declare private psychiatrist Online treatment costs on my insurance?A5: Many private health insurance prepares cover psychiatric care, but it's vital to check your policy's specifics concerning coverage limits and
